Elixir Festival: Celebrating arts, music and storytelling from the Middle-East and Africa

Elixir Festival is a new mini-festival which is launching at Grand Junction in April 2024. Named for the Arabic al-‘iksīr (also known as the Elixir of Life), a symbol of healing, the festival celebrates and connects the diverse cultures of the Middle East and Africa, showcasing a line-up of international and local contemporary artists, featuring theatre, music, Eid celebrations, workshops, and food, celebrating contemporary arts from the Middle East, North Africa, and Anatolia.

Performers will include Palestinian singer Ruba Shamshoum, the Scottish/Egyptian duo, the Ayoub Sisters, Kurdish-Anatolian singer-songwriter Olcay Bayir and much else besides.
